Output 2fb2ef36bda667316549bc98dfdd7639e3874cae62d59e8e18b027e9b2f48c3e:0

value
8316656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4fba974549f837ad1cfa5155ada60589c2f76c1 OP_EQUAL
address
3M7AezLP7wa67vZ438GYJLiqdsJTuKMx6C
transaction
2fb2ef36bda667316549bc98dfdd7639e3874cae62d59e8e18b027e9b2f48c3e
spent
true